Shrink PNG File Sizes

PNGs are a fantastic choice for image formats due to their transparency and quality. However, they can sometimes be bulky. Fortunately, compressing PNG sizes is achievable with several techniques. Begin by assessing the original image. Look for areas that you can crop unnecessary elements or reduce color complexity. Use an online tool or software that focuses on PNG compression, choosing a level compatible to your needs. Remember, while achieving the smallest file size is desirable, don't neglect image quality too much. Experiment with different settings to find the ideal balance.

  • Leverage lossless compression algorithms designed for PNGs.
  • Experiment various compression levels to find the sweet spot between size and quality.
  • Think about alternative image formats like JPEG if a smaller file size is paramount.

Boosting PNG Files

Looking to minimize the bulk of your PNG images?? There are a number of fantastic programs out there to help you attain this. Some popular solutions include TinyPNG,pngquant,ImageOptim, which offer automatic compression methods. For more manual control, Photoshop,GIMP,Paint.NET provide adjustments for fine-tuning your reduction. Experiment with different tools and stages of compression to find the perfect balance between quality and file size.

  • Always back up your original files before compressing them!
